Anyway, back to the set. Timid + 204 Speed on Scarf Kyogre most usefully outspeeds all +Speed nature Deoxys-A, while having a few EVs to spare and put into HP, not max Speed like the standard.


Ice Beam and Thunder provide great coverage, while Hydro Pump gives much needed power, enough power to just barely KO Mewtwo.

You need proof? Ok, you will recieve said proof.

Timid Scarf Kyogre with 399 Sp.Atk does 100.85% - 118.93% to Standard Mewtwo in Rain with Hydro Pump.

Water Spout is lovely when I have very high HP, which is early in the game, how I love just shooting it at everything. ;)

While Toxic may seem like a novelty, it stops Ludicolo from walking all over this set, Thunder has only a very small chance to 2HKO, about 7% before Leftovers recovery.

Forretress, boasting an 140 Base Def and Rapid Spin + multiple entry hazards, is a staple to any Uber Stall team in my opinion. Toxic Spikes in Ubers is quite valuable, there are almost no Poison-types to stand in the way, and those Flying-types are punished brutally by Stealth Rock. Rapid Spin, is one of the 2 main reasons to use it on a Stall team, pushing Stealth Rock, Spikes and Toxic Spikes back. Explosion is one of the "mini-reasons" I use Forretress, giving off a grand finale instead of just rolling over and dieing.

I find two problems.

Specs Kyogre: Your team is slow, so even Specs Kyogre can outspeed 4 of your members. Everytime it comes you loose huge amount of health. Blissey is 2HKOed like Dialga, Giratina and Kyogre too. You don't need ask what happens to Mewtwo and Forretress.

Bulk Up Dialga: It has easy time to Bulk Up few times and then kill everything. Giratina somewhat stops it, but after one BU it loose 40% of it's health. Everything else is set-up food. Mewtwo and Forretress can't do nothing etc. Huge lategame threat.

Solution: I would use more attack oriented Mewtwo. Specs Mewtwo with 363 SAtk always 2HKO the most special defence oriented Dialgas. You could use bulky spread with Light Screen. Who can guess that Specs Mewtwo can have a Light Screen? Nobody!

Specs Kyogre is problem, but just put 96 SDef EVs to Giratina to make Water Spout 3HKO.
